What does a user experience researcher intern do?

A User Experience (UX) Researcher Intern assists in studying how users interact with products and services to improve their overall experience. They help plan and conduct user interviews, surveys, usability tests, and analyze data to uncover user needs and pain points. Their findings guide design and development teams in creating more user-friendly products. This role is ideal for those interested in understanding human behavior and making technology more accessible and enjoyable.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a user experience researcher intern, and why are they important?

To thrive as a User Experience Researcher Intern, you need a foundational understanding of UX research methods, human-centered design principles, and typically a background in psychology, HCI, or a related field. Familiarity with usability testing tools, survey platforms, and data analysis software like UserTesting, Qualtrics, or Excel is often required. Strong communication skills, curiosity, and empathy help interns effectively gather insights and collaborate with cross-functional teams. These skills ensure that user feedback is accurately collected and translated into actionable recommendations, driving product improvements.

How does a user experience researcher intern typically collaborate with designers and product managers during a project?

As a User Experience Researcher Intern, you'll regularly partner with designers and product managers to gather and share user insights that directly inform product decisions. You'll be involved in planning and conducting user studies, then synthesizing and presenting your findings in team meetings or workshops. Your work helps ensure design solutions address real user needs and align with business goals, so clear communication and a collaborative mindset are essential. Expect to participate in brainstorming sessions, provide feedback on design prototypes, and help prioritize user-centered improvements.
